Abstract

1336982 Battery power-pack D FLINN and E HARRISON 25 Nov 1970 [25 Nov 1969] 55964/70 Divided out of 1334651 Heading H1B [Also in Division H2] A power pack 10 for use under water comprises one or more batteries 16 in a housing 12 which is filled with an insulating liquid 14 and which is vented by a duct 18 having its lower end open to the liquid 14 and its upper end open to the environment above the normal level of the liquid in the housing. Gas evolved in use is retained within the housing and forces sea water-and/or a small amount of the liquid 14 from the duct 18, according to the surrounding water pressure. When on the surface, gas pressure may be released by a vent 22. The liquid 14 is preferably oil and the housing is provided with terminals 20. The power pack drives a D.C. motor (see Division H2) of an under-sea rock drill.
